Welcome to Episode 12 of Writers Theatre's podcast - The Green Room. Each episode, we'll be joined by some of the industry's most illustrious artists for intimate conversations about art, theatre, and the world around us.

Today, we're joined by Kimberly Senior and Jessie Fisher, the director and star of Every Brilliant Thing by Duncan Macmillan and Jonny Donahoe.⁠⁠⁠⁠⁠⁠⁠⁠⁠⁠ Kimberly and Jessie talk about their friendship and creative partnership, the participatory elements of Every Brilliant Thing, and read an excerpt from Kimberly's new book, What Would a Person Do: Thoughts on Directing and Living.

Kimberly Senior

Guest

Kimberly Senior is a freelance director whose award-winning work has been seen in 15 states in over 200 productions. She directed the Broadway production of the Pulitzer Prize, Tony nominated Disgraced by Ayad Akhtar. Kimberly directed the HBO special Chris Gethard: Career Suicide and her work in audio has ranged from Marvel’s The Wastelanders to C13’s Ghostwriter. She is a member of the Goodman Theatre’s Artistic Collective and has taught at a number of universities. She is a proud union member of SDC and even prouder mother of Noah (18) and Delaney (16). She is the author of What Would a Person Do?: Thoughts on Directing and Living, available on Amazon.

Jessie Fisher

Guest

Jessie Fisher is delighted to make her Writers Theatre debut. Broadway: Girl in Once, Delphi in Harry Potter and the Cursed Child (OBC), Jaye in A Beautiful Noise (OBC). Regional: GroundedWhat the Constitution Means to Me (Milwaukee Rep), ConstellationsOf Mice and Men (Steppenwolf), OthelloThe Heir ApparentTaming of the Shrew (Chicago Shakespeare), 33 Variations (TimeLine), The PrideAbraham Lincoln was a F- (About Face) and work with The Hypocrites, ATC, Chicago Children’s Theatre and The Gift. TV: Chicago JusticeChicago PDBoss. Jessie is a teacher, composer, improviser and birth doula. She stays busy, curious and hopeful.

Kristin Hammargren

Host

Kristin Hammargren is the Associate Director of Arts Engagement at Writers Theatre. Her work includes programming around mainstage productions, community partnerships, onsite education, theatre for young audience programs and the Show & Tell storytelling series. Kristin originally joined the company as a teaching artist in 2017. Outside of WT, she has worked as an educator with Filament Theatre, Victory Gardens, AdventureStage, the "Cherubs" program at Northwestern, Oregon Shakespeare Festival, and Montana Shakespeare in the Schools. For five years she served as the director of Yellowstone TheatreMakers in Bozeman, MT. As a performer, Kristin's credits include work with Steep Theatre, BoHo Theatre, Filament Theatre, Midsomer Flight, Opera Montana, Montana Shakespeare in the Parks, Forward Theater, and Door Shakespeare.
